All-you-can-drink for 2 hours is 2200 yen or 1800 yen. There are a lot of sweet fruit sours that girls seem to like, so it's also recommended for girls' nights out. Unique menu items that all have "na." at the end of their words. Free refills on the tofu salad. The tofu, mascarpone, salted koji taja, and salted konbu on top of the Chinese cabbage, lettuce, and other leafy vegetables are all mixed together, and it's a unique and exquisitely delicious dish that I keep refilling.
